Rating8.1The activities program at ATELIER leans toward culture and wellness rather than competitive sports or water-park style entertainment. Art workshops, cooking classes, and tequila tastings are more representative of what most guests here actually do with their days than beach volleyball or poolside games. Motorized water sports and golf cost extra and are arranged through external providers.


The main social pool at 1,360 m² (14,639 sq ft) with a swim-up bar and regular activity programming. This is where most of the daytime energy concentrates. Heated. The swim-up bar here (Limón y Sal) gets busy by mid-morning — arrive early for a good spot.
At 209 m² (2,250 sq ft), this is the smaller, calmer option closer to the beach. Also has a swim-up bar, but the vibe is deliberately quieter. Guests who find the main pool too active migrate here. Heated.
Heated infinity pool on the fifth floor at El Cielo, exclusively for INSPIRA suite guests. The views over the ocean are the main draw — one of the better rooftop pool settings in the Cancun resort market. Naturally less crowded due to the INSPIRA-only access.
Private heated pool area with Bali beds and dedicated pool concierge. INSPIRA access only. Quieter and more attentive service than any of the open pools. The Bali beds fill up quickly even within the INSPIRA guest population — arrive early to claim one.
Semi-private heated swim lanes with direct terrace access from Swim-Out suite categories. The semi-private nature means the lane is shared with adjacent suites — not fully private, but significantly less traffic than the main pools.
Private heated outdoor plunge pools on the terraces of Ocean Front and Rooftop INSPIRA suite categories. Genuinely private — the most exclusive pool option on property. Available only in the higher INSPIRA room tiers.
White sand beach with calm, clear water protected by Isla Mujeres — the natural barrier keeps waves minimal and the water swimmable without fighting currents. Seaweed is markedly less of an issue here than on Hotel Zone beaches. Lounge chairs and Bali beds available throughout the day with drink service. Kayaking and paddleboarding launch from here at no extra charge. INSPIRA Beach offers a separate, less crowded section with upgraded service for INSPIRA guests.
Non-motorized water sports from the beach, included in all rates. The calm water protected by Isla Mujeres makes these practical — not just available. Good for morning use before the beach gets crowded.
Pool-based fitness classes for all levels. A social activity that draws a consistent crowd at morning and midday sessions. The aqua gym format works well in the heated pools.
Leisurely sailing sessions from the beach. The calm, protected water makes this more accessible than sailing at exposed beach properties. Availability varies — check the daily schedule at the activities desk.
Beach volleyball, Spike Ball, Boccia, tennis, basketball, pickleball, mini-golf, and archery all available. The variety is broader than most all-inclusive properties in this tier. Pickleball courts are a relatively new addition and fill quickly.
Complimentary bikes for exploring the resort grounds and surrounding Playa Mujeres area. The neighborhood is relatively low-traffic and bikeable compared to the Hotel Zone.
Full Technogym equipment including weights, cardio machines, and a multifunctional room for TRX. One of the better-equipped resort gyms on this stretch of coast — the Technogym brand matters for guests who train regularly.
Yoga by the water, Zumba, aqua aerobics (standard, stretching, and strength formats), and boot camp sessions. Check the daily schedule — morning yoga by the beach is the most popular slot and fills up.
Evening shows at the theater including the Sand Show and 80's Tribute productions. Quality is consistently better than the typical all-inclusive entertainment program — several guests mention the shows as a highlight.
Musical performances at El Cielo and Bar de La Calle most evenings. The rooftop setting for El Cielo music performances is the standout — worth timing a drink there on a show night.
Silent disco nights and karaoke sessions at El Deseo. More of a late-night activity than an early evening one. The silent disco format works well for a property that otherwise keeps noise levels low.
Special evenings including Caribbean Dinner with a fire show and salsa classes. Check what's scheduled during your stay dates — theme nights often overlap with the best dining and entertainment combinations of the week.
Hands-on sessions covering guacamole, ceviche, and sushi preparation with culinary staff. The guacamole class in particular is frequently cited as a memorable and fun afternoon activity.
Expert-guided tastings at Bar La Cantina covering multiple tequila varieties. Genuinely educational sessions rather than just a marketing event — the staff knowledge level is high. Reserve a spot early in your stay.
Salsa instruction and performances including Prehispanic Contemporary Mexican shows. The dance lessons are participatory — not just watching. Good for couples who want an activity they can do together.
Painting, ceramics, Huichol bead art, and piñata making offered throughout the week. The Huichol art class in particular connects to the resort's Mexican art and design identity. Exhibitions change periodically and are worth viewing on arrival.
Functions as the resort's late-night venue after shows end. Stays open into the early hours. The only space on property that functions like a nightclub — suits guests who want to extend their evening beyond the bar circuit.
Jet skiing and parasailing through external companies at extra cost. Not included in any room rate. Book directly with the beach vendors — pricing is per session and non-negotiable.
Diving excursions arranged through external providers at additional cost. The waters near Playa Mujeres and Isla Mujeres offer good visibility for reef diving. Not included — factor the extra cost into your budget if diving is important.
Access to the 18-hole Playa Mujeres Golf Club at discounted rates for standard guests. INSPIRA guests staying 7+ nights get two complimentary rounds. The course is Jack Nicklaus-designed and plays along the lagoon — one of the better resort-adjacent courses in the Cancun area.
Day trips to Chichen Itza, Tulum, Isla Mujeres, and fishing excursions booked at the concierge desk at extra cost. The Isla Mujeres trip is the shortest and most popular — the ferry from Puerto Juárez is nearby. Chichen Itza from here is a full-day commitment.
